WebbNew Jersey Glass Factory's. The first successful glass factory venture in the 13 original colonies during and after British rule was the United Glass Company at Wistarburgh in the year 1739. The factory site was located near present day Alloway New Jersey. From this factory a family of German immigrants named Stenger anglicized to Stanger who ... brunswick television budget

WebbCanberra Glassworks, historic building Canberra, Australia, 10 February 2016. The Kingston Powerhouse is an historical building, and included on the ACT Heritage Places Register. It is a building of industrial and architectural significance.
